Global Flexible Video Borescope Market to Reach 550 Million USD in 2025

Published2025-06-06

Flexible video borescopes are advanced inspection tools designed for visual inspection in hard-to-reach or inaccessible areas. These devices consist of a flexible, slender tube equipped with a miniature video camera at the tip, allowing operators to navigate through intricate structures, pipes, or machinery. The flexible nature of the borescope enables it to bend and articulate, providing a clear view of objects or components in spaces that are otherwise challenging to access. The live video feed from the camera is typically transmitted to an external display or a portable device, allowing real-time inspection and documentation. Flexible video borescopes find applications in various industries, including aviation, automotive, manufacturing, and maintenance, facilitating non-destructive testing and enabling professionals to identify potential issues or defects without the need for disassembly.

Market Overview and Growth Outlook

According to WENKH’s latest analysis, the global flexible video borescope market is projected to reach 550 Million USD in 2025. Growing demand for high-precision, portable devices in medical diagnostics and industrial inspection is broadening application scenarios. Advances in materials and imaging technologies have improved durability and image quality while lowering the usage threshold, fueling rapid adoption. The market is expected to expand at a 5.84% CAGR, reaching 818 Million USD by 2032.

Product Segmentation and Performance Characteristics

By diameter, the market is divided into 0–6 mm and above 6 mm categories. Borescopes in the 0–6 mm range, valued for their flexibility and ability to navigate narrow, complex spaces, account for over 50% of market share. They are widely used in medical endoscopy, internal industrial equipment inspections, and precision machinery maintenance. Models above 6 mm offer higher optical performance and durability, making them ideal for large-diameter pipelines and equipment in oil, chemical, and construction industries. The 0–6 mm category is experiencing the fastest growth, driven by minimally invasive medical trends and industrial automation, while larger-diameter models face substitution pressure from miniaturized products.


Downstream Applications and Demand Trends

Flexible video borescopes are applied across general industry, automotive, aerospace, construction, and other sectors. The automotive industry holds over 30% of market share, using these devices extensively for inspecting engines, exhaust systems, and vehicle interiors. General industrial applications include equipment maintenance, pipeline inspections, and mechanical repairs. Aerospace uses focus on internal structure checks and assembly monitoring, while construction applications involve pipeline installation, wall inspections, and structural safety assessments. Aerospace is the fastest-growing segment due to rising precision inspection requirements in the aviation sector.


Competitive Landscape and Leading Manufacturers

The market is highly competitive, with the top five manufacturers controlling about 62% of global share. Key players include Olympus, Baker Hughes, SKF, Mitcorp, Yateks, viZaar, Gradient Lens, Lenox Instrument, 3R, AIT, Shenzhen Jeet Technology, etc. These companies leverage strong R&D capabilities, broad product portfolios, and strategic global presence to drive market expansion. Their offerings range from ultra-fine medical borescopes to robust industrial-grade systems, with increasing integration of AI-based inspection and measurement features.

Regional Market Insights

North America, led by the US and Canada, benefits from a mature medical device industry and well-established clinical applications. In comparison, Europe—notably Germany, France, and the UK—focuses on high-precision, multifunctional devices for healthcare, aerospace, and energy. While the Asia-Pacific region is the fastest-growing, with China, Japan, South Korea, and India driving demand through healthcare modernization and industrial automation. The Middle East & Africa are still in early development stages, relying heavily on imports. And the Latin America—led by Brazil, Mexico, and Argentina—shows steady growth as equipment replacement cycles accelerate.

Future Prospects and Industry Direction

As imaging resolution, device miniaturization, and smart functionalities advance, flexible video borescopes are expected to penetrate further into both medical and industrial domains. The push toward AI-assisted diagnostics, remote inspection capabilities, and more durable, lightweight materials will enhance usability and open new market opportunities. Companies that can combine high performance with affordability are poised to capture emerging demand across developing markets.
